2. Operating income (EBIT) is $40,000. Variable operating expenses are 75% of sales and operating fixed expenses are $10,000. Calculate operating leverage (OLE). What will NOPAT be if sales decline by 20%. Assume a 40% tax rate. CM = contribution margin. OLE = CM/EBIT
